The Role
As a Senior Medical Writer, prior in-depth experience with background researching, developing, and writing for the diverse array of deliverables within medical publications and medical communications is expected and will be an integral foundation for this role. Based on this and the overall description, the SMW role will fall broadly across the following approximate allocations:
- 75% of your time will be devoted to content development and writing, from inception to delivery, including but not limited to:
- The accurate interpretation of clinical data (e.g., from clinical study reports, safety summaries, biostatistical tables, published articles, etc.) and its accurate, concise adaptation to meet assigned projects' stated objectives.
- All compliance requirements for medical publications and medical communications, as relevant and appropriate (e.g., authorship guidelines, journal requirements, client confidential materials, etc.).
- Representing assigned work at internal and external (client) meetings as required (e.g., project status, author interactions, client publication committee meetings, etc.).
- Understanding and contributing to client publication and communication plans as required (e.g., impact on project timelines, appropriate congress and journal venues for assigned client/therapy area, relevance to client drug development planning, etc.).
- 20% of your time will be devoted to assisting in the management of medical writing resources, including but not limited to:
- Monitoring and helping to manage the medical writing workload, including for junior/other writers, as required.
- Collaboration with the SD and account managers to help ensure adherence to agreed-upon timelines (e.g., project status reports, proactive flagging of problems, resource limitations/availability, etc.).
- Assisting in the onboarding and mentoring of new and junior medical writers, as required.
- 5% of your time may be devoted to assisting the SD and/or GMC Senior Leadership in business development activities including but not limited to:
- Background research and writing support for new business proposals.
- Background research and writing support for assigned account(s).
- Organic growth opportunities.
What You Need
- Advanced degree, preferably PhD but PharmD and MD may also be considered.
- Prior relevant experience in a medical publications/medical communications agency preferred.
- Minimum of 3-5 years' experience of high-level content development; applicants with 1-2 years' experience as a Senior Medical Writer while at a medical communications agency preferred.
- Proven history of relevant high-level writing support, including proficiency with ICMJE and GPP guidelines; ability to read, analyze, and interpret scientific and technical journal content; ability to develop and write to prescribed styles and formats.
- Ability to work efficiently with network directories/databases.
- Familiarity and ability to work with industry standard resources (e.g., PubMed/Medline, clinicaltrials.gov, various market intelligence/data analytic providers, etc.).
- Ability to work with cross-functional teams (e.g., editorial/library services, graphics/digital services, presentations support, etc.).
- Proficiency with commonly used software including but not limited to word processing (e.g., MS Word), graphics (e.g., PowerPoint or Prism), and bibliographic software (e.g., EndNote), and adaptability to other applicable software as may be required from time to time.
- Experience in resource organizing and mentoring strongly preferred.
- Must have demonstrable command of the English language (read, write and speak).
- A strong desire to be a key part of a global network of services that lead to better outcomes for its clients, its people and for patients.
